Garlinge is a neighbourhood in Kent with a population of 3,486. The median house price is £320,000, with 96 sales in the past 12 months and prices rising 19.6% over five years. Detached homes cost a median of £486,250, whilst terraces average £256,250.

The area is relatively deprived, with about 55% of neighbourhoods in England more deprived than Garlinge. Air quality is good: nitrogen dioxide levels are low and particulate matter is moderate. Flooding risk is negligible. Broadband coverage is excellent, with 92.6% gigabit-capable connections. The median age is 46.9 years. Owner-occupation is strong at 78.2%, with 45.1% owning outright. Education attainment is mixed: 23.6% hold Level 4 qualifications or above, though 21.4% have no qualifications. The area lies within Thanet District Council, rated Labour-controlled. Two conservation areas protect parts of Garlinge, and five listed buildings stand here.
